Making robust software demands the use of efficient algorithms, but programmers seldom think about them until a dilemma occurs. Algorithms described in brief a number of existing algorithms for solving a lot of difficulties, and aid you select and implement the algorithm for your needs -. With just enough math to assist you realize and analyze algorithm performance

By focusing on demand rather than theory, this book gives efficient code solutions in many programming languages you can effortlessly adapt to a particular project. Each and every key algorithm is presented in the style of a style pattern that consists of information to assist you realize why and when the algorithm is suitable
With this book you will: Solve a particular problem of coding or improve performance of an existing solution. Quickly locate algorithms that relate to the problems you want solved, and determine why a particular algorithm is the right one to use.

